The Democrats destroyed American shipyards when they passed a luxury tax on new boats. Why pay for a new boat with the tax when one could go overseas and not pay it? Of course everyone went overseas for the boats and Americans lost jobs and manufacturers went out of business. The tax was finally gotten rid of in the mid-90's but now states are starting to think about bringing it back. There are always consequences to raising taxes. Raise a tax and people stop buying from American companies and who suffers? Not the rich guy. He still gets his boat, just from Europe. The ones who suffer are the workers who build the damn things.
